以南京北郊为例,测量分析了屋面径流中砷(As)、汞(Hg)、铅(Pb)、镉(Cd)和锌(Zn)5种元素的浓度、形态特征。结果表明:短时强降雨过程中这5种元素浓度在较大范围内无规则波动,且不同元素间浓度分布存在较大差异;Zn 与Pb 的平均浓度分别高于《地表水环境质量标准》(GB 3838—2002)的Ⅴ类和Ⅳ类标准限值,污染程度从大到小依次为 Zn >Pb >As >Hg >Cd。元素形态分析表明,径流中除 Hg 外其他4种元素主要以颗粒态形式存在,各元素颗粒态占总形态的平均分数分别为:As,64.5%;Hg,43.7%;Pb,76.5%;Cd,54.6%;Zn,54.3%。

In this study,the pollution characteristics of arsenic (As),mercury (Hg),lead (Pb),cadmium (Cd)and zinc (Zn)were determined for short-term roof runoff with condition of construction-fugitive-dust.Re-sults indicated that the concentration of elements varied to a high degree during the rainfall period,and it indica-ted big difference between different elements concentration.Based on both event mean concentrations and fluxes, it can be concluded that the elements pollution may be ranked as Zn >Pb >As >Hg >Cd.In terms of fractiona-tion,elements in the particulate phase dominated the runoff pollution;the mean fraction of elements in the partic-ulate phase to total phase was 64.5%,43.7%,76.5%,54.6% and 54.3%,respectively for As,Hg,Pb,Cd and Zn.
